Metered dose dispensing aerosol valve
First Claim
1. A metered dose dispensing aerosol valve for a container comprising a valve body defining an aperture, a seal mounted at the aperture, a metering chamber, a tank seal, a transfer passage through which a quantity of substance to be dispensed can pass from the container into the metering chamber and a valve stem having a dispensing passage, the valve stem being moveable through the seal such that in a first position the dispensing passage is isolated from the metering chamber and the metering chamber is in communication with the container via the transfer passage and in a second position the dispensing passage is in communication with the metering chamber to allow substance to be dispensed from the metering chamber through the dispensing passage and the transfer passage is isolated from the metering chamber, and the valve stem extending, at least in said second position, through the tank seal, wherein the transfer passage comprises a mechanical flow valve positioned towards the end of the transfer passage adjacent the metering chamber, which in said first position, allows substance to be dispensed to pass from the container into the metering chamber but not out of the metering chamber.

Abstract
A metered dose aerosol valve that minimizes loss of prime and loss of drug dose by having a one-way valve mechanism positioned toward the end of a transfer passage that allows drug substance to pass from the aerosol container into the metering chamber, but not back.
